Breanne “Bree” Schlereth’s journey is one marked by quiet courage and unwavering faith. A former PAC-12 All-American gymnast at the University of Arizona, her life has stretched far beyond the arena. As the wife of former MLB player Daniel Schlereth and the proud mother of three—Quinn, Drew, and Zane—Bree’s story is deeply rooted in resilience, grace, and transformation.

She has walked through fire and come out stronger. A cancer survivor, Bree knows what it means to fight for her life. She has held her child through open-heart surgery and stood in truth as a survivor of one of the most devastating abuse scandals in sports history. And through it all, she’s learned that pain is not what breaks us—it’s what shapes us.

In 2018, Bree was honored with the Arthur Ashe Courage Award, a recognition that speaks to the strength she carries—not just for herself, but for those who haven’t yet found their voice.
